This bill amends the definition of "student with a disability" in the North Dakota Century Code, specifically in section 15.1-32-01. The updated definition clarifies that a "student with a disability" is an individual aged three to twenty-one who requires special education and related services due to various conditions.
Key changes include the insertion of "deaf or hard of hearing" in place of "impairment, including deafness," and the removal of the term "emotional disturbance" which has been replaced with "emotional disability." Additionally, the phrase "other health impairment" has been modified to "An other health impairment." These changes aim to provide clearer and more inclusive language regarding the conditions that qualify a student for special education services.
